Replace NSScroller instances in NSScrollView?


  • Subject: Replace NSScroller instances in NSScrollView?
  • From: Jim Correia <email@hidden>
  • Date: Fri, 21 Aug 2009 12:22:27 -0400

I have a subclass of NSScrollView in which I'm also using a custom NSScroller subclass.

If I am unarchiving from a NIB, I can set the object classes for the NSScroller to my subclass.

However, there doesn't appear to be an API to specify the class of the scroller used when I alloc+init an NSScrollView, nor does there seem to be an API to replace the default scrollers with my custom scrollers.

Have I overlooked the solution?
